Jazzville crush TJ Dark Knights to lift PBBL-Western Union Season 13 Cup

Jazzville lit up the scoreboard from beyond the arc to crush TJ Dark Knights 88-64 and lift the PBBL-Western Union Season 13 Cup at Asma Bint Al Nouman Gym in Dubai.

Chris Elopre, who was adjudged Final MVP, exemplified Jazzville’s hot shooting with his almost perfect showing from the three-point area, making five of six attempts, to lead his team with 21 points.

He was also effective in ball distribution and filled up the stat sheet with a double-double performance after dishing out 11 assists.

Season MVP Jake Antonio also had a productive night, contributing 17 points, including three triples and five rebounds. Sam Perez made two three-pointers and finished with 14 markers while Ton Eligado and Von Gile added 12 and 10 points respectively.

TJ Dark Knights staged a short rally in the first few minutes of the fourth quarter but Elopre and Antonio quickly doused the rally with back-to-back triples en route to a big 24-point winning margin.

“We had a slow start but we worked on our defence and forced our opponents to commit numerous turnovers,” Jazzville coach Roland Crisostomo said. “Our outside shooting was lethal but we also had good ball movement and we always found the open man.”

“Winning the championship can be attributed to our fine work ethic – we hold team practice regularly,” added Crisostomo, whose team never experienced a defeat since the elimination round.”

For his part, TJ Dark Knights team captain Winston Lopez said: “We were not able to sustain the lead we built in the first quarter because we were caught flat-footed by Jazzville’s defence and suddenly our outside shooting went dry.”

Lopez and Enrico Bawic led TJ Dark Knights with 11 points each while Mark Bautista and Reydan Mabilog added 10 apiece.
